The perimeter of a circular coin is 720 meters. Find the circumference of the coin. |
|
2 |
Hint |
Formula used |
\$"Circumference" = 2\pi r\$ |
3 |
Step |
We know that the perimeter of a circle is equal to the circumference of the circle. So, we can use the formula P = 2πr, where P is the perimeter and r is the radius of the circle. |
|
4 |
Step |
Perimeter of the circular coin |
720 meters |
5 |
Step |
We need to find the radius of the circle. We know that the perimeter is given as 720 meters, which is equal to 2πr. So, we can write |
720 = 2πr ⇒ r = \$"720"/"2π"\$ |
6 |
Step |
Now that we have found the radius of the circle, we can use the formula for circumference, C = 2πr, to find the circumference of the coin |
\$"C" = 2\pi \times "720"/"2π"\$ ⇒ \$"C" = 720\$ |
7 |
Step |
Hence, the circumference of the coin |
\$720\$ meters |
